What Is Considered the Best Hospital in India?

The best hospital in India is a healthcare institution that consistently demonstrates excellence in patient outcomes, specialist expertise, infrastructure, and quality standards.

First, it is important to understand that there is no single hospital that is universally best for every patient. For example, a patient seeking cancer treatment may benefit more from a specialized oncology center, while someone requiring a heart transplant may need a hospital known for advanced cardiac care.

Moreover, hospital rankings typically evaluate factors such as medical expertise, treatment outcomes, research contributions, technology adoption, patient satisfaction, and accreditation status. According to global and national healthcare rankings, hospitals such as AIIMS Delhi, Apollo Hospitals, Medanta, CMC Vellore, and Fortis Memorial Research Institute consistently appear among India’s leading institutions.

How Are Hospitals Ranked in India?

Hospitals in India are ranked using clinical excellence, infrastructure quality, patient outcomes, accreditation, and reputation among healthcare professionals.

According to major healthcare surveys, thousands of doctors and specialists contribute opinions when evaluating hospitals. The Week-Hansa Research Survey, one of India’s most recognized healthcare rankings, consults over 2,300 healthcare professionals when assessing hospitals.

What Is the Difference Between Government and Private Hospitals in India?

Government hospitals focus on affordability, while private hospitals typically offer faster access, premium infrastructure, and advanced patient services.

Government Hospitals

Advantages:

  • Lower treatment costs
  • Highly qualified specialists
  • Public healthcare support

Disadvantages:

  • Longer waiting times
  • Higher patient volume

Private Hospitals

Advantages:

  • Faster appointments
  • Modern facilities
  • Personalized patient care

Disadvantages:

  • Higher treatment costs

For example, AIIMS offers highly affordable treatment, while Apollo and Medanta provide premium private healthcare experiences.

Why Are NABH and JCI Accreditations Important?

NABH and JCI accreditations are quality certifications that indicate adherence to healthcare safety and operational standards.

NABH is India’s leading hospital accreditation body, while JCI is recognized internationally. Hospitals holding these certifications demonstrate commitment to patient safety, clinical quality, and operational excellence.

According to NABH leadership, only a small percentage of India’s hospitals currently hold full accreditation, making accreditation an important quality indicator.

How Much Does Treatment Cost at India’s Leading Hospitals?

Treatment costs vary significantly depending on the hospital, specialty, and complexity of care.

Estimated Treatment Costs

Treatment

Typical Cost Range

Heart Surgery

₹2 lakh – ₹8 lakh

Knee Replacement

₹1.5 lakh – ₹5 lakh

Liver Transplant

₹20 lakh – ₹35 lakh

Cancer Treatment

₹1 lakh – ₹30 lakh+

Brain Surgery

₹3 lakh – ₹15 lakh

For example, government hospitals may provide subsidized treatment, while premium private hospitals charge higher fees in exchange for faster access and additional services.

What’s Next: How Should You Choose the Right Hospital?

Choosing the right hospital requires balancing expertise, affordability, accessibility, and treatment requirements.

First, identify the specific specialty you need. For example, cancer patients should prioritize oncology centers, while transplant patients should evaluate transplant success records.

Second, compare accreditation, doctor experience, and treatment outcomes.

Third, obtain a second opinion before major procedures. This process can improve confidence and help you understand alternative treatment options.

Finally, review insurance coverage and expected costs before scheduling treatment.
